About Us
OSA houses The Oregon School of Arts & The Gallery. We offer classes, workshops, demos and other fun events for artists of all abilities and ages. And we have monthly exhibitions open to everyone to exhibit and view.
How We Got Started
OSA was born by a group of conservative artists who were involved the Portland Art Museum in 1926. This group wanted to teach and exhibit independently. In the 1950's, they built our current building proving a permanent space for instruction and exhibition. Over time we have diversified course offerings and opened The Gallery to the community, anyone can exhibit here.
